The famous mystery manga "Don't Talk About Reasoning" created by Japanese cartoonist Yumi Tamura will be adapted into a live-action TV series. The official announced the news today on June 3. The drama will be starred by Masaki Suda and will be broadcast in January 2022. Stay tuned. "The Unspoken Reasoning" is a mystery comic created by Japanese cartoonist Yumi Tamura. It features a mysterious young man named Kunou who looks confused but can remain calm and composed. He uses his keen observation to carry out amazing reasoning. Kunou, who has no intention of revealing the essence of things but somehow can solve all kinds of strange cases, is able to solve all kinds of strange cases. The protagonist of the live-action TV series "The Unspoken Mystery" will be played by Masaki Suda, Kunou. It is scheduled to be broadcast in January 2022.
